Output 31076541e248c28fedcee5ded303f6835c35eed0cebe7c93310b75f6fcb486f6:9

value
6353190
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db3c46ec24344a07a02253c1bc5a1402269163d9 OP_EQUALVERIFY OP_CHECKSIG
address
1LzDC8ifU9HdRj4q3pxdzYNdysuZGvo3m6
transaction
31076541e248c28fedcee5ded303f6835c35eed0cebe7c93310b75f6fcb486f6
confirmations
597583
spent
true